Butterburgers And Sandwiches

The ButterBurger is the heart of Culver’s menu. Each patty is cooked to order and placed on a lightly buttered, toasted bun. You can choose from single, double, or triple patties.

Frozen Custard And Desserts

Frozen custard is what makes Culver’s stand out. It is made fresh daily and has a rich, creamy texture. You can get it in a dish, cone, or as a sundae.

Concrete Mixers are custard blended with mix-ins like candy pieces, cookie dough, or fruit. They are thick and served upside down to show the quality.

Nutritional Information

If you are watching your calories, here are some key facts. A Single ButterBurger has about 480 calories. A small fries adds 320 calories. A small vanilla custard has 200 calories.

For a lighter meal, choose the Grilled Chicken Salad with vinaigrette. It has around 350 calories. The Garden Fresco Salad is also a good choice at 280 calories.

You can find full nutritional information on Culver’s website or ask at the counter. They provide allergen guides too.
